The story of Hazel Pace began in 1918 in Burley, Idaho. In 1920, Hazel Pace resided in Springdale, Cassia, Idaho, USA. In 1930, Hazel Pace resided in Burley, Burley, Cassia, Idaho, USA. Hazel Pace married Lauren Peterson South, and had children including Carolyn South, George South, Michael South, Richard South, Steven John South. Hazel Pace passed away in 1996 in Pocatello, Bannock, Idaho, USA.
